Key Responsibilities
- Conduct comprehensive, face-to-face assessments with patients.
- Manage symptoms and provide palliative care to alleviate pain and discomfort.
- Oversee patient admissions, discharges, certifications, recertifications and medication management.
- Assure appropriate evaluation, certification, and recertification of terminal prognosis at the time of admission and at the end of each certification period.

Core responsibilities: The Medical Director ensures high-quality end-of-life care by managing symptoms, conducting patient assessments, and leading a multidisciplinary team. They are responsible for certifying terminal prognoses and overseeing clinical operations and regulatory compliance within the hospice setting.
